Description

Review of basic theory: discrete time signals and systems, Fourier theory and related theorems, sampling, multi-rate sampling and reconstruction, quantisation, time/frequency resolution, Z transform and related theorems, Laplace transform. Topics selected from: signal analysis, one-dimensional filter structure design (FIR, IIR, ARMA) with implementation on DSP hardware (processing in real-time), multi-rate structures, introduction to two-dimensional structures including array filters and beamformers, introduction to Kalman filtering, introduction to signal estimation, finite precision arithmetic effects.
